    Le TAO has been on my bucket list for a while as it's gained popularity from social media. They use…read morefresh Hokkaido milk and cream and are known for their Asian cake and soft serve. They are located in the Bravern across from HeyTea (don't forget to bring your parking ticket for validation at the cafe)! The cakes are beautifully displayed like artwork, but much smaller than I expected. Each cake is only 7" (for reference, a standard cake is 8" or 10") and the height of one layer. For $70 a cake (or $10 per slice), these cakes are priced like they're made from gold. My friend and I got a FROMAGE DOUBLE SLICE ($9.99) and a SIGNATURE CAKE SET ($13.99) which includes one slice of cake plus latte of your choice; we got the MATCHA STRAWBERRY CAKE plus a ROSE LATTE. Note that the matcha strawberry and double chocolate fromage cakes are only available as whole cakes or sets and not slices (minus one star just for that). The FROMAGE DOUBLE SLICE was rich, light, and tasted like fresh whipped cream (as the name suggests). It came with some dabs of strawberry syrup on the side, which my friend and I thought was definitely needed as the cake itself was relatively bland. At least it wasn't too sweet (I'd probably rate it as 25% sweetness). The MATCHA STRAWBERRY SLICE was better as it had very strong matcha concentration with a hint of strawberry. It also came with strawberry syrup, but unlike the Fromage, it wasn't necessary. With that said, this cake slice was half the size of the Fromage slice, measuring maybe 2x3 inches maximum or the length of half a finger. It was ridiculously small (like petit four size) for $13.99, even if it came with a latte. The ROSE LATTE was alright. You could taste the rose syrup and the coffee and milk were smooth, but nothing to write home about. The interior is meant to look like a fancy designer store with modern furnishings and lighting (which to be fair, it is located in the Bravern among the designer shops). They have about 8 tables indoors (honestly pretty tight together) or you can take your dessert to go. Service was decent and a waiter brought our food to the table within 10 minutes. TLDR: cake are overpriced for the small portions and their signature cake isn't that tasty. Maybe I'll come back and try the Mont Blanc with Hokkaido soft serve, but $13.99 for half a cup of ice cream is stretching it. Overall: 2.5/5 for food, 3.5/5 for service, 3.5/5 for interior
